I like to think of myself at home in the armchair, writing, smoking and occasionally wandering down the shop.
Stephen Fry
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ote reflects a sense of comfort in solitude and the creative process.

In this quote, Stephen Fry conveys the joy and contentment he finds in a simple, quiet life filled with writing and occasional outings. The imagery of being at home in an armchair suggests a personal sanctuary where creativity flourishes, and the mention of wandering down to the shop adds a touch of everyday reality, emphasizing the balance between introspection and engaging with the world.
